        AP Chemistry Unit 1 introduces students to the world of chemical bonding, properties, and reactions. At its core, the unit explores the principles of atomic structure, periodic trends, and the bonding theories of Lewis and VSEPR. Students learn to apply these concepts to understand the properties and behaviors of different substances, laying the groundwork for more advanced topics in the course. By grasping the basics of Unit 1, students can better comprehend the intricacies of chemical systems and make informed decisions in various fields.

    In the United States, AP Chemistry has become a popular course among high school students, with over 200,000 students taking the exam in 2020. The subject's complexity and rigor make it an attractive challenge for students aiming to excel in science, technology, engineering, and mathematics (STEM) fields. As the demand for STEM professionals continues to grow, understanding the fundamental concepts of chemistry has become essential for future success.

        Understanding atomic structure is vital in AP Chemistry, as it enables students to comprehend the behavior of elements and compounds. By grasping the concepts of atomic radius, electron configuration, and periodic trends, students can predict the properties and reactivity of different substances.
